Transaction 120c81dbe69fa1cce6a425e2a5c498139ef0ce22fe58cdd167bfa27f7ac47ef4

7 Input
2 Outputs
  • 120c81dbe69fa1cce6a425e2a5c498139ef0ce22fe58cdd167bfa27f7ac47ef4:0
  • value  2799900000
    address  14EK63xev3i1CrYfRR29UC8QKEDZULC3EB
  • 120c81dbe69fa1cce6a425e2a5c498139ef0ce22fe58cdd167bfa27f7ac47ef4:1
  • value  1000607
    address  1DZQ6Gr2cc4MJvKmqnE35hLnatELmuTuu